All You Need To Know About PTFE Sliding Bearings

PTFE sliding bearings, also known as slide bearings, are essential components in various industrial applications These bearings are designed to allow smooth, low-friction movement between two surfaces, reducing wear and tear while providing stability and support In this article, we will explore the benefits, features, and applications of PTFE sliding bearings.

PTFE, which stands for polytetrafluoroethylene, is a synthetic polymer that offers excellent chemical resistance, low friction, and high temperature resistance These properties make PTFE an ideal material for sliding bearings in industries where harsh conditions, high loads, and extreme temperatures are common.

One of the key advantages of PTFE sliding bearings is their low coefficient of friction This means that the bearings can move smoothly and effortlessly, reducing the need for lubrication and maintenance Additionally, PTFE has a high load-bearing capacity, which allows these bearings to support heavy loads without deformation or failure.

Another important feature of PTFE sliding bearings is their resistance to chemicals and corrosion PTFE is inert to most chemicals, making it suitable for use in industries where exposure to corrosive substances is a concern This resistance to chemical attack ensures the longevity and reliability of PTFE sliding bearings in harsh environments.

PTFE sliding bearings are also capable of operating at high temperatures without compromising their performance PTFE has a high melting point and can withstand temperatures up to 260°C, making it suitable for use in applications where heat resistance is critical This property allows PTFE sliding bearings to maintain their integrity and functionality under extreme temperature conditions.

Some of the key applications of PTFE sliding bearings include:

1 Bridge and building construction: PTFE sliding bearings are used to support and accommodate thermal expansion and contraction in bridges and buildings These bearings help to reduce friction and wear between structural components, ensuring the stability and longevity of the structures.

2 Pipeline and equipment installations: PTFE sliding bearings are used in pipelines and industrial equipment to facilitate movement and alignment during installation These bearings allow for easy adjustment and positioning of heavy components, reducing the risk of damage and deformation.

3 Machinery and automotive applications: PTFE sliding bearings are commonly used in machinery and automotive systems to reduce friction and improve efficiency These bearings help to optimize performance, increase lifespan, and minimize maintenance requirements in various mechanical applications.
